Up for sale is the legendary Meridian 602 CD Transport, an absolute classic of British high-end digital engineering designed by Allen Boothroyd and Bob Stuart. Renowned for its dual-enclosure chassis, glass front panels, and ultra-low jitter dual-clock architecture, the 602 remains one of the most musically detailed CD transports ever built. Still uses the original Philips CDM mechanism

Operational Status:
The unit powers on and plays CDs, delivering the pristine audio output Meridian is famous for. However, it is being sold AS-IS / FOR REPAIR or SERVICE due to intermittent startup behavior:
Upon cold boot the tray will open OR close but wont do both without a quick restart. once the disc is loaded however it reads and plays. I suspect its either tray door/power supply or drive belt related and should be repairable from any tech.
Once it initializes and begins playback, it operates and tracks. If left on I have had no continued issues with boot/CD changing until later turned off.
This is typical for vintage 600-series units and usually points to aging power supply filter capacitors or a weak drawer belt/laser mechanism needing routine maintenance/re-capping.
